Transaction 16bcd381c8a3af885086a1c7c2af3fe40caafdd8ed1b9fc4b694996a4ea44833

1 Input
2 Outputs
  • 16bcd381c8a3af885086a1c7c2af3fe40caafdd8ed1b9fc4b694996a4ea44833:0
  • value  1921307
    address  1HaBfE4NW2s3b13xmhoospaATpcEUXj7Zu
  • 16bcd381c8a3af885086a1c7c2af3fe40caafdd8ed1b9fc4b694996a4ea44833:1
  • value  53269
    address  37SBhodvBKm7Ja1rCWYoB4vYkUfJDBWqFQ